  • Page 3 10.4“ Handheld Operating Panel HBG 1011 The HBG 1011 is a handheld operating device for visualizing processes. Process diagnos- tics, operating and monitoring of processes are thereby simplified. A touch screen serves as the input medium for process data and parameters.

    10.4“ HANDHELD OPERATING Device HBG 1011 Designated Use The Safety functions implemented in the product are designed for use with safety applica- tions in a PLC control and meet the required conditions for safe operation in compliance with SIL 3, HFT 1 according to EN IEC 62061 and in compliance with PL e, Cat. 4 in ac- cordance with EN ISO 13849-1.

    10.4“ HANDHELD OPERATING DEVICE HBG 1011 Electrical Requirements Supply voltage typically +24 V DC (PELV) minimum +24 V DC (PELV) maximum +30 V DC (PELV) Supply voltage (UL) +24-30 V DC (NEC Class 2 or LVLC) Current consumption typically 550 mA...

    10.4“ HANDHELD OPERATING DEVICE HBG 1011 Environmental Conditions Storage temperature -10 ... +60 °C Ambient temperature 0 ... +45°C Humidity 10-90 %, non-condensing Operating conditions pollution degree 2 altitude up to 2000 m EMC stability EN 61000-6-2 (industrial area) (increased requirements according to EN IEC 62061) ≤...

    10.4“ HANDHELD OPERATING Device HBG 1011 Key Switch The key switch is implemented two-stage and in series with the confirmation switch. Confirmation Switch The confirmation switch is three-stage. The confirmation switch must be activated with the key switch, since they are connected in series. If the switch is not pressed or pressed only partially, it is inactive.

    10.4“ HANDHELD OPERATING Device HBG 1011 11 Transport/Storage This device contains sensitive electronics. During transport and storage, high mechanical stress must therefore be avoided. For storage and transport, the same values for humidity and vibration as for operation must be maintained! During transport, temperature and humidity fluctuations may occur.
